Motorola 56000 | |
---|---|
Perustietoja | |
Kehittäjä | Motorola |
Valmistaja | Motorola, Freescale Semiconductor, NXP Semiconductors |
Arkkitehtuuri ja luokitus | |
Piiriluokka | Digitaalinen signaaliprosessori |
Motorola 56000 on Motorolan kehittämä sarja digitaalisia signaaliprosessoreja (DSP) signaalinkäsittelyä varten, julkaistu vuonna 1986.[1][2]
Motorola aloitti 1980-luvun puolivälissä DSP-kehityksen ja kysyi muun muassa audiolaitteiden valmistaja Peaveyltä mitä nämä haluaisivat.[3] Motorola 56000 oli 24-bittinen prosessori, jossa oli noin 150 000 transistoria.[3] 24-bittiä valittiin ideaalisena audionäytteistykseen tuolloin.[3] 56001 on identtinen 56000:n kanssa lukuun ottamatta siinä olevaa RAM-muistia.[3]
56000-sarjaa valmistettiin vuoteen 2012 saakka, jolloin Freescale Semiconductor lopetti sen erillisenä tuotteena.[3] Suoritinta valmistetaan edelleen muihin tuotteisiin integroituna.[3]
96002 perustui 56000-sarjalle ja ohjelmistot olivat lähdekooditasolla yhteensopiva.[4]
Prosessori käyttää muokattua Harvardin arkkitehtuuria, jossa on kolme muistiavaruutta ja -väylää.[5]
56000-sarja käyttää kiinteädesimaalista aritmetiikkaa liukulukulaskennan sijaan.[5] Liukulukulaskenta on haastavampaa ja vaatii enemmän suorituskykyä kuin kiinteädesimaalinen.
Prosessoria käytettiin tietokoneissa kuten NeXT, Atari Falcon (56001)[6] ja SGI Indigo työasemissa.
Prosessori on nopea esimerkiksi FFT suorituksessa, joka on signaalinkäsittelyssä yleinen algoritmi.
Käyttökohteita ovat tyypillisesti äänentoistolaitteet, kommunikaatiolaitteet, tutkajärjestelmät ja sulautetut järjestelmät.[5]